With this optical illusion, Albers experiments Together with the notion of Room by depicting how an arrangement of simple traces can produce an ambiguous feeling of spatial depth. The black rectangular shapes intersect one another from various angles to disorient the viewer's notion of what is in front and what's driving.

Op art Probably extra closely derives from your read more constructivist techniques of the Bauhaus.[7] This German college, Launched by read more Walter Gropius, pressured the connection of form and function in a read more framework of study and rationality. Learners learned to give attention to the overall style and design or whole composition to current unified performs.
